 - # Flags to make gcc output dependency info.  Note that you need to be
 - # careful here to use the flags that ccache and distcc can understand.
 - # We write to a dep file on the side first and then rename at the end
 - # so we can't end up with a broken dep file.
 - depfile = $(depsdir)/$(call replace_spaces,$@).d
 - DEPFLAGS = -MMD -MF $(depfile).raw
 - 
 - # We have to fixup the deps output in a few ways.
 - # (1) the file output should mention the proper .o file.
 - # ccache or distcc lose the path to the target, so we convert a rule of
 - # the form:
 - #   foobar.o: DEP1 DEP2
 - # into
 - #   path/to/foobar.o: DEP1 DEP2
 - # (2) we want missing files not to cause us to fail to build.
 - # We want to rewrite
 - #   foobar.o: DEP1 DEP2 \
 - #               DEP3
 - # to
 - #   DEP1:
 - #   DEP2:
 - #   DEP3:
 - # so if the files are missing, they're just considered phony rules.
 - # We have to do some pretty insane escaping to get those backslashes
 - # and dollar signs past make, the shell, and sed at the same time.
 - # Doesn't work with spaces, but that's fine: .d files have spaces in
 - # their names replaced with other characters.
 - define fixup_dep
 - # The depfile may not exist if the input file didn't have any #includes.
 - touch $(depfile).raw
 - # Fixup path as in (1).
 - sed -e "s|^$(notdir $@)|$@|" $(depfile).raw >> $(depfile)
 - # Add extra rules as in (2).
 - # We remove slashes and replace spaces with new lines;
 - # remove blank lines;
 - # delete the first line and append a colon to the remaining lines.
 - sed -e 's|\\||' -e 'y| |\n|' $(depfile).raw |\
 -   grep -v '^$$'                             |\
 -   sed -e 1d -e 's|$$|:|'                     \
 -     >> $(depfile)
 - rm $(depfile).raw
 - endef

 - # Due to circular dependencies between libraries :(, we wrap the
 - # special "figure out circular dependencies" flags around the entire
 - # input list during linking.
 - quiet_cmd_link = LINK($(TOOLSET)) $@
 - cmd_link = $(LINK.$(TOOLSET)) -o $@ $(GYP_LDFLAGS) $(LDFLAGS.$(TOOLSET)) -Wl,--start-group $(LD_INPUTS) $(LIBS) -Wl,--end-group
 - 
 - # We support two kinds of shared objects (.so):
 - # 1) shared_library, which is just bundling together many dependent libraries
 - # into a link line.
 - # 2) loadable_module, which is generating a module intended for dlopen().
 - #
 - # They differ only slightly:
 - # In the former case, we want to package all dependent code into the .so.
 - # In the latter case, we want to package just the API exposed by the
 - # outermost module.
 - # This means shared_library uses --whole-archive, while loadable_module doesn't.
 - # (Note that --whole-archive is incompatible with the --start-group used in
 - # normal linking.)
 - 
 - # Other shared-object link notes:
 - # - Set SONAME to the library filename so our binaries don't reference
 - # the local, absolute paths used on the link command-line.
 - quiet_cmd_solink = SOLINK($(TOOLSET)) $@
 - cmd_solink = $(LINK.$(TOOLSET)) -o $@ -shared $(GYP_LDFLAGS) $(LDFLAGS.$(TOOLSET)) -Wl,-soname=$(@F) -Wl,--whole-archive $(LD_INPUTS) -Wl,--no-whole-archive $(LIBS)
 - 
 - quiet_cmd_solink_module = SOLINK_MODULE($(TOOLSET)) $@
 - cmd_solink_module = $(LINK.$(TOOLSET)) -o $@ -shared $(GYP_LDFLAGS) $(LDFLAGS.$(TOOLSET)) -Wl,-soname=$(@F) -Wl,--start-group $(filter-out FORCE_DO_CMD, $^) -Wl,--end-group $(LIBS)

 - # Helper to compare the command we're about to run against the command
 - # we logged the last time we ran the command.  Produces an empty
 - # string (false) when the commands match.
 - # Tricky point: Make has no string-equality test function.
 - # The kernel uses the following, but it seems like it would have false
 - # positives, where one string reordered its arguments.
 - #   arg_check = $(strip $(filter-out $(cmd_$(1)), $(cmd_$@)) \
 - #                       $(filter-out $(cmd_$@), $(cmd_$(1))))
 - # We instead substitute each for the empty string into the other, and
 - # say they're equal if both substitutions produce the empty string.
 - # .d files contain ? instead of spaces, take that into account.
 - command_changed = $(or $(subst $(cmd_$(1)),,$(cmd_$(call replace_spaces,$@))),\
 -                        $(subst $(cmd_$(call replace_spaces,$@)),,$(cmd_$(1))))
 - 
 - # Helper that is non-empty when a prerequisite changes.
 - # Normally make does this implicitly, but we force rules to always run
 - # so we can check their command lines.
 - #   $? -- new prerequisites
 - #   $| -- order-only dependencies
 - prereq_changed = $(filter-out FORCE_DO_CMD,$(filter-out $|,$?))
